Real Sociedad forward Carlos Vela has admitted that he could one day return to Arsenal, according to Sky Sports.

The 24-year-old only joined the Spanish side last summer after spending the previous year on loan with them in a successful spell that saw him bag 12 goals in 37 games.

Sociedad were impressed enough to make the deal permanent and already this year he’s scored 13 in 32.

His time at Arsenal was tempestuous to say the least. Six years in North London saw him make just 62 appearances in amidst several loan spells with the likes of West Bromwich Albion, Osasuna and Salamanca as well as Sociedad.

However, seemingly finally settled in Spain, his form has prompted speculation over his former employers activating a buy back clause in his contract which would allow Arsene Wenger to bring him to the Emirates once again.

Vela, aware of the talk, has admitted that a return could be possible, but for the time being he’s happy to help Real in their bid to finish in fourth place and qualify for next season’s Champions League.

“Going back to Arsenal? It could happen at any moment, but I don’t want to think about it,” he said.

“My life is at Real Sociedad, and it is with that shirt that I want to play in the Champions League next season.”
